getid3分析音频文件
2019-06-16 09:37
99 查看
下载一个时长 01:01:31 的音频到本地 $cont = file_get_contents('http://audio.xmcdn.com/group48/M01/C9/EC/wKgKlVuOS3DTuvNIAcf6jxoR3Qs090.m4a'); file_put_contents('D:/phpStudy/PHPTutorial/WWW/audio/audio.m4a', $cont); CMD进入audio目录 git clone https://github.com/JamesHeinrich/getID3.git 下载音频操作类 test.php-------------------- include_once('./getID3/getid3/getid3.php'); $path = './audio.m4a'; $getID3 = new getID3(); $info = $getID3->analyze($path); print_r($info); 注释: filesize 文件大小 playtime_string 格式化的时长,字符串 playtime_seconds 时长,秒 可见,分析的还是很准确的。 因此,在后台上传音频之后就可以分析出音频的所有信息。
相关文章推荐
- wav音频文件格式分析
- 深度分析:Android4.3下MMS发送到附件为音频文件(音频为系统内置音频)的彩信给自己,添加音频-发送彩信-接收彩信-下载音频附件-预览-播放(三,接收彩信<1,接收短信>)
- AMR音频编码器概述及文件格式分析
- 深度分析:Android4.3下MMS发送到附件为音频文件(音频为系统内置音频)的彩信给自己,添加音频-发送彩信-接收彩信-下载音频附件-预览-播放(三,接收彩信<2,下载彩信>)
- AMR音频编码器概述及文件格式分析
- MP3文件的ID3V1信息与ID3V2信息结构的分析
- AMR音频编码器概述及文件格式分析
- 深度分析:Android4.3下MMS发送到附件为音频文件(音频为系统内置音频)的彩信给自己,添加音频-发送彩信-接收彩信-下载音频附件-预览-播放(二,发送彩信<2>)
- wave格式分析,wave音频文件格式分析配程序
- AMR音频编码器概述及文件格式分析
- PHP 保存远程文件到服务器代码管用(包括使用getid3获取音频文件属性的用法)...
- 音频文件ID3解析
- AMR音频编码器概述及文件格式分析
- 获取音频文件的ID3信息
- AMR音频编码器概述及文件格式分析 (2)
- 使用Java sound播放音频文件出现“文件类型不支持”报错的原因分析
- iredmail下安装脚本分析(一)---get_all.sh 文件所在目录为PKGS
- 深度分析:Android4.3下MMS发送到附件为音频文件(音频为系统内置音频)的彩信给自己,添加音频-发送彩信-接收彩信-下载音频附件-预览-播放(二,发送彩信<2>)
- GetFileVersionInfo 获取文件版本信息错误原因分析